The Real Problem: Hybrid Learning’s Hidden Connectivity Gap
Hybrid learning is not just about uploading materials to the cloud or adopting new apps. At its core, it’s about reliable communication. IT teams across educational institutions frequently report:
- Dropped video calls during live lectures
- Overloaded access points in hostels and public areas
- Student complaints about lag during online assessments
Supporting these challenges, industry data shows:
- Nearly 99% of students bring multiple devices to campus, with approximately 23% connecting four or more devices simultaneously, dramatically increasing Wi-Fi load and complexity.
- Over 70% of university IT teams experience network congestion during peak usage hours, impacting the quality of online and hybrid classes.
- Up to 60% of Wi-Fi-related support tickets stem from unstable or slow connectivity that disrupts teaching and learning.

The Solution: Purpose-Built Managed Wi-Fi for Education
Leading IT departments are moving away from fragmented fixes and adopting fully managed, enterprise-grade Wi-Fi solutions tailored for modern academic demands.
Here’s what defines a high-performance managed Wi-Fi network:
- Campus-wide, seamless coverage with consistent high-speed access across all indoor and outdoor learning environments, no more dead zones.
- Automatic traffic prioritization of real-time classes, virtual exams, and collaboration tools receives priority, eliminating buffering and latency during critical moments.
- Scalability on demand easily accommodate new devices, increased enrollment, or additional facilities without extensive infrastructure changes.
- Robust security and compliance are centralized, oversight prevents unauthorized access and protects sensitive data, supporting education-specific compliance standards.
- Proactive monitoring and maintenance 24/7 oversight identifies and resolves issues often before users even notice them.
